Managing the Knocked-Out Tooth



If you have actually knocked senseless a tooth, manage it carefully to increase the possibilities of successful reattachment. First, situate the tooth and choose it up by the crown, staying clear of touching the root. It's critical to keep the tooth moist, so if possible, try to gently position it back right into the socket.

Immediate First Aid Tips



Beginning by carefully rinsing your mouth with lukewarm water to cleanse the location around the knocked-out tooth. This will assist eliminate any kind of dirt or debris that may exist. Beware not to scrub or touch the origin of the tooth, as this can create additional damages.

Next off, ideally, attempt to position the tooth back into its outlet. Hold it in position by delicately attacking down on a clean item of gauze or cloth. If you can't reinsert the tooth, don't force it. Rather, maintain it moist by putting it in a mug of milk or saline remedy. Avoid saving the tooth in water as it can damage the origin cells.

To manage any kind of bleeding, use gentle stress to the location using a clean gauze or towel. You can additionally apply a chilly compress to reduce swelling and ease pain. Bear in mind to take over-the-counter pain drug as required.

Seeking Emergency Dental Treatment



When managing a knocked-out tooth, seeking emergency situation oral care immediately is critical to increase the opportunities of conserving the tooth. Contact your dental expert right away or head to the nearby emergency situation oral center. Time is of the essence in such scenarios, as the quicker you get therapy, the greater the chance of successful re-implantation.
